At AMD's Computex question and answer session on Wednesday, the organization shared the primary subtle elements on what's accompanying Ryzen's second era Threadripper CPU. Threadripper is the enormous daddy of AMD's new CPU line: it is anything but a gaming CPU, however, it's a multithreaded, multicore creature. What's new: second-gen Threadripper, following the dispatch of other Ryzen contributes the most recent couple of months, is coming in Q3 of 2018. Gracious, and it has up to 32 centers.

AMD is inclining toward some "substantial metal" symbolism to advertise Threadripper, and the CPU seems as though it'll acquire it. Threadripper 2 will keep running on a 12nm Zen+ design and have the new highlights of Ryzen second gen. It's running on a similar attachment and will arrive in various designs, however, the most astounding end chip will have an immense 32 centers and 64 strings. Just 24 hours prior, Intel prodded a 28-center top of the line chip for discharge in the not so distant future. AMD saved no time finishing that with Threadripper.

AMD showed 24-center and 32-center chips running on air cooling at the question and answer session, tearing through a few benchmarks. It will be a decent year for top of the line registering.
